Answer:

y= 0.8

Step-by-step explanation

4(3−y) = 6−2(1−3y)

12−4y = 6−2(1−3y)

12−4y = 6−2+6y

12−4y = 4+6y

  12   =  4+10y

     8 = 10y

  0.8 = y
